What body defense needs to be reduced in the patient following organ transplantation?
 
  A) Major histocompatibility complex
  B) Barrier defenses
  C) Lymphoid tissues
  D) Eosinophils

When administering milrinone (Primacor), the nurse will assess the patient for what common adverse effect?
 
  A) Hypoglycemia
  B) Confusion
  C) Hypotension
  D) Seizures

Answer to Question 1

A
Feedback:
The major histocompatability complex is the genetic identification code carried on chromosomes and produces several proteins called histocompatibility antigens located on the cell membrane that allow the body to recognize cells that are self-cells. Cells without these proteins, such as those in a transplanted organ, are identified as foreign and are targeted for destruction so this defense must be minimized to prevent damage to the transplanted organ. Barrier defenses prevent entry of pathogens into the body. Lymphoid tissue creates cellular components of the mononuclear phagocyte system, differentiates T cells, and regulates actions of the immune system. Eosinophils respond to allergic responses. Barrier defenses, lymphoid tissue, and eosinophils are not involved in the transplant rejection process.

Answer to Question 2

C
Feedback:
The adverse effects most frequently seen with these drugs are ventricular arrhythmias (which can progress to fatal ventricular fibrillation), hypotension, and chest pain. Hypoglycemia, confusion, and seizures are not generally adverse effects of milrinone.
